Night time fishing is among us
This time of your are began to only crappie fish at night for a number of reason. First off it is way too hot to be baking under the Sun catching crappie unless I find a bridge or some type of shade to fish under. The fish think this way also they will be no structure that has shave or under bridges. If you can stand the Sun you can Target these areas wherever you are. All the spots that I posted over the last few months are great night fishing spots right now. It is best to get an LED light or if the old school you can use a lantern. If you try this you will notice the big fish that will circulate under the light and that's where the crappie will be. A great night spot right now will be Pahokee Pier, Nubbin Slough and Canal point. You have a question let me help to direct message me. Good luck.
